引言
在过去的十年中,区块链技术无疑是最引人注目的技术之一。随着比特币和其他加密货币的崛起,越来越多的人希望了解如何下载和使用区块链软件。区块链的分布式特性和强大的安全性使其在金融、供应链和医疗等领域得到了广泛的应用。本文将向您介绍如何安全快速地下载区块链软件,并讨论相关的技术、应用和安全性等问题。
区块链软件的种类
在进行区块链下载之前,我们首先需要了解有哪些类型的区块链软件。主要有以下几种:
- 节点软件 — 这种软件用于连接和维护一个区块链网络的节点。例如,比特币的完整节点软件会下载整个区块链并参与到网络中。
- 钱包软件 — 数字货币的保管和交易通常需要钱包软件,可以分为热钱包(在线)和冷钱包(离线)。
- 开发工具 — 如果您是开发者,您可能需要一些开发工具,例如Truffle、Ganache等工具帮助您创建和测试智能合约。
- 区块链平台 — 一些如Ethereum、Hyperledger等开放平台提供了开发和部署智能合约的解决方案。
- 区块链浏览器 — 用于查看区块链上交易记录、区块数据等的工具,如Etherscan和Blockchain.com。
如何安全下载区块链软件
安全下载区块链软件是任何用户都必须关注的问题。以下是一些重要的指导原则:
- 官网或可信来源 — 始终从官方或信誉良好的第三方网站下载软件。检查网址的安全性,确保是HTTPS连接。
- 检查数字签名 — 大部分官方软件会提供电子签名来验证文件的完整性。使用这些签名检查下载文件是否被篡改。
- 防病毒软件 — 在下载和安装软件之前,确保本地计算机已经安装了有效的防病毒软件,并保持更新。
- 使用虚拟机或沙盒环境 — 在真实环境中安装前,可以使用虚拟机或沙盒环境测试软件的安全性。
区块链下载的流程
如果您已经选择了合适的区块链软件,下面是下载和安装的一般流程:
- 访问官网 — 打开区块链软件的官方网站。
- 选择下载版本 — 根据您的操作系统(Windows, macOS, Linux等)选择相应的版本。
- 下载文件 — 点击下载链接,开始文件的下载。
- 验证文件完整性 — 下载完成后,用提供的哈希值或数字签名检查文件是否完整。
- 安装程序 — 根据指引完成软件安装。
区块链应用的前景与挑战
区块链技术正逐渐渗透到多个行业中,其应用前景非常广阔,但也面临着一些挑战:
- 金融技术 — 区块链在金融领域的应用体现在去中心化交易、降低交易成本等方面。
- 供应链管理 — 区块链可以提高供应链透明度,帮助企业追踪商品来源及流向。
- 医疗记录管理 — 区块链可确保医疗记录的安全和隐私,受控的提供给需要访问的医务人员。
- 法规和法律问题 — 区块链的去中心化特性使得其合规性面临挑战,各国对加密货币和区块链的法规不尽相同。
可能相关问题
以下是五个可能与
区块链下载相关的问题,以及对这些问题的详细阐述:
区块链软件下载后如何验证其安全性?
在互联网中下载软件,无论是区块链应用或是其他类型的软件,确保下载文件的安全性是至关重要的。在下载后,您可以通过以下几个步骤进行验证:
- 检查哈希值 — 下载页面一般会提供对应文件的哈希值,您可以使用SHA256等工具进行计算,确保您下载的文件哈希值与官网公布的值一致。
- 数字签名验证 — 某些软件发布时会同时提供数字签名,使用相应的公钥对软件进行验证,确保该文件未被修改。
- 社区评论和反馈 — 访问一些技术论坛或社交媒体,了解其他用户对于该软件的评价和反馈,提前识别潜在问题。
遵循以上步骤有助于确保您下载的区块链软件是安全且可靠的,降低潜在的安全风险。
区块链下载对计算机配置有什么要求?
由于不同的区块链应用和软件对计算机性能的需求各不相同,以下是一些常见的配置要求:
- 内存 — 许多完整节点的区块链软件下载对内存的需求较高,至少要有8GB的内存,而一些大型区块链可能需要16GB甚至更高。
- 存储空间 — 完整节点需下载整个区块链,这意味您需要足够的硬盘空间,通常需要数十GB以上,甚至达到几百GB。
- 网络速度 — 高速稳定的网络很重要,因为区块链下载需要从多个节点获取数据,一般推荐使用宽带互联网。
- 处理器性能 — 较快的处理器能有效提升节点的处理速度,建议使用多核CPU以提高性能。
根据软件的不同要求,您可以相应调整计算机配置,以获得最佳的使用体验。
下载的区块链软件该如何使用?
下载并安装好区块链软件后,如何使用也显得尤为重要。以下是一些基础步骤:
- 创建账户 — 如果软件需要,可以进行注册或创建您的数字钱包,设置强密码,确保资金安全。
- 同步区块链 — 对于完整节点软件,首次使用时需要同步整个区块链,这可能会花费一些时间。
- 进行交易 — 使用钱包功能进行数字货币的接收和发送,可以根据对方的地址进行转账。
- 管理设置 — 根据需要调整软件的设置,例如备份钱包、创建多重签名地址等。
了解相关的基础操作可以帮助用户更好地使用下载的区块链软件,从而享受其带来的便利。
区块链下载是否永久免费?
大多数区块链软件通常是免费提供的,特别是一些开源项目,这意味着用户可以自由地下载和使用。然而,以下几点值得注意:
- 部分收费应用 — 一些商业化的区块链应用可能需要支付费用,比如专业版钱包软件或某些企业级解决方案。
- 交易费用 — 即使软件本身免费下载,交易过程中仍需支付区块链网络所需的手续费,这通常是基于区块链网络的负载决定的。
- 附加服务费用 — 有些平台可能会提供附加的服务,例如数据分析或客户支持,这通常是收费的。
因此,在选择使用某款区块链软件时,需了解其具体的费用结构,以及在使用过程中可能出现的任何其他费用。
区块链下载后是否需要更新?
是的,下载后的区块链软件是需要定期进行更新的。这是因为:
- 安全性 — 软件更新通常会修复已知的安全漏洞,从而增强系统的保护,降低被攻击的风险。
- 性能 — 开发者会不断根据用户反馈和最新技术对软件进行,更新版本往往能够提高软件的性能。
- 功能增强 — 随着技术的发展,新的功能和改进也适时推出,通过更新,用户能够享受到最新的功能。
通过定期维护和更新,用户能够确保所使用的区块链软件处于最佳状态,提升使用体验。
总结
总之,区块链下载是每个希望参与这一新兴技术的用户的关键步骤。在选择并使用软件之前,了解相关软件的类型、安全性、系统要求、使用方法以及更新的重要性是非常必要的。通过遵循安全下载指南,选择合适的设备配置,定期更新软件,用户能够更好地享受区块链技术所带来的多种优势。